Dayton is a city in Ohio that has a rich history and culture. It is known as the birthplace of aviation, as the Wright brothers invented and flew the first airplane here. Dayton also has many attractions and places of interest for visitors and residents alike. Here is some information about Dayton that you might find useful. According to the 2020 U.S. census, Dayton has a population of 137,644 people, making it the sixth-largest city in Ohio.
